Irrigation Trenching in Atlanta, GA
Irrigation trenching services involve excavating narrow channels in the ground to install or repair underground irrigation systems. This process is commonly used for projects such as laying new sprinkler lines, replacing aging pipes, or expanding existing irrigation coverage across lawns, gardens, or commercial landscapes. Property owners typically seek this service to ensure efficient water distribution, reduce manual watering efforts, and maintain healthy, lush landscapes.
Before requesting irrigation trenching, property owners should consider the size and layout of their property, the location of existing utilities, and the type of irrigation system planned or existing. It’s also helpful to understand the scope of the project, including the length of trenches needed and any specific site conditions that might affect excavation. Clear communication about these details can help ensure the trenching work meets the landscape’s watering needs effectively.

Irrigation Trenching Questions
What is irrigation trenching? Irrigation trenching involves digging narrow channels to install or repair underground watering systems for lawns and gardens.
What types of projects require trenching? Trenching is used for installing sprinkler lines, drip irrigation systems, or replacing damaged underground pipes.
How deep are irrigation trenches typically dug? Trenches are usually excavated between 6 to 12 inches deep, depending on the system and property needs.
What should property owners consider before trenching? It's important to plan the layout carefully to avoid existing utilities and ensure proper coverage for irrigation zones.
